B&H Photo Video (also known as B&H Photo and B&H and B&H Foto & Electronics Corporation) is an American photo and video equipment retailer founded in 1973, based in Manhattan, New York City. [1] B&H conducts business primarily through online e-commerce consumer sales and business to business sales, as they only have one retail location.
Spiratone was a company specializing in low-cost lenses and filters for cameras, lighting, and darkroom equipment. The company was started by Fred Spira in 1941 in the bathroom of his parents' apartment where he developed film.
